    Pharmacy Technician - Community Pharmacy

    Openings for Pharmacy Technician I, II, and III. Scheduled Weekly Hours – various positions available (fulltime and part time). Work Shift – rotating or evening only (rotating if can only have one). The Pharmacy Technician reports to the Pharmacy Coordinator. Under general supervision, the Pharmacy Technician supports the drug distribution activities of the Department of Pharmacy Services.

    Assists a registered pharmacist with support activities and processes required to dispense medical prescriptions. Collects, inputs, and verifies prescription, refill, and patient information. Receives and stocks incoming supplies. May prepare labels and routine prepacked orders. May be expected to perform some clerical duties relating to the department.

    Education: High School Degree or Equivalent Work Experience: 0-6months

    Current registration as a Pharmacy Technician by the South Carolina Board of Pharmacy (SCBOP). This technician must complete the PTCB board certification exam and pass within 6 months of hire.
